Output 51ba0d33f871e30bbd7ead5ce8bc4ab54723ec2b2a985255c88610477345fec0:1

value
212310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c61b8c64fd66f3926289262202f967534decac8 OP_EQUAL
address
34H5uk3pq1YT2MfQtuBiRoQXhuE79zSYPa
transaction
51ba0d33f871e30bbd7ead5ce8bc4ab54723ec2b2a985255c88610477345fec0
spent
true